当前位置: 首页 > wzjs >正文

顺义企业建站费用2022拉新推广平台

顺义企业建站费用,2022拉新推广平台,wordpress安装主题需要ftp,上海网站建设哪家1.1 Pandas概述 核心概念: Pandas 是基于 NumPy 的数据分析库,核心数据结构:Series(一维)和 DataFrame(二维)。 应用场景:数据清洗、转换、统计分析、时间序列处理。 特点&#x…

1.1 Pandas概述

  • 核心概念

    • Pandas 是基于 NumPy 的数据分析库,核心数据结构:Series(一维)和 DataFrame(二维)。

    • 应用场景:数据清洗、转换、统计分析、时间序列处理。

  • 特点

    • 支持异构数据、缺失值处理、灵活的数据对齐。


1.2 Pandas基本操作

  • 数据读写

    df = pd.read_csv('data.csv')       # 读取 CSV
    df.to_excel('output.xlsx')        # 写入 Excel
  • 数据查看

    df.head(5)      # 前5行
    df.info()       # 数据结构
    df.describe()   # 统计摘要
  • 数据选取

    df['column']    # 单列
    df[['col1', 'col2']]  # 多列

1.3 Pandas索引

  • 索引类型

    • 行索引:df.index(默认 RangeIndex)

    • 列索引:df.columns

  • 设置索引

    df.set_index('date', inplace=True)  # 指定列为索引
    df.reset_index()                    # 重置索引
  • 多层索引(MultiIndex):

    df = df.set_index(['year', 'month'])  # 分层索引

1.4 groupby操作

  • 基础分组聚合

    df.groupby('category')['price'].mean()  # 按类别分组计算均价
  • 多级分组

    df.groupby(['year', 'month']).sum()
  • 自定义聚合函数

    def range_agg(x):return x.max() - x.min()
    df.groupby('group').agg(range_agg)

1.5-1.7 数值运算与对象操作

  • 数值运算

    df['col'].sum() / df['col'].cumsum()  # 累加和
    df.apply(np.sqrt)                     # 应用函数
  • 字符串操作(需转换为 str 类型):

    df['name'].str.upper()                # 转大写
    df['email'].str.contains('@gmail')    # 匹配子串
  • 对象类型处理

    df['col'].astype('category')          # 转换为分类类型

1.8 merge操作

  • 表连接

    pd.merge(left, right, on='key', how='inner')  # 内连接

  • 参数详解

    • howleftrightouterinner

    • suffixes: 解决列名冲突(如 _x_y


1.9 显示设置

  • 调整显示选项

    pd.set_option('display.max_rows', 100)   # 最多显示100行
    pd.set_option('display.float_format', '{:.2f}'.format)  # 浮点数格式

1.10 数据透视表

  • 快速汇总

    pd.pivot_table(df, values='sales', index='region', columns='year', aggfunc=np.sum)
  • 多层透视

    pd.pivot_table(df, index=['region', 'year'], values='sales', aggfunc=[np.mean, np.sum])

1.11-1.12 时间操作

  • 时间解析

    df['date'] = pd.to_datetime(df['date'])  # 转为时间类型
    df['year'] = df['date'].dt.year         # 提取年份
  • 时间序列重采样

    df.resample('M').mean()                 # 按月重采样
    1.13-1.14 Pandas常用操作
  • 去重与排序

    df.drop_duplicates(subset='col')        # 去重
    df.sort_values(by='col', ascending=False)  # 排序
  • 缺失值处理

    df.dropna()                             # 删除缺失值
    df.fillna(method='ffill')               # 前向填充

1.15 Groupby操作延伸

  • 分组后过滤

    df.groupby('group').filter(lambda x: x['value'].mean() > 10)  # 筛选组
  • 分组应用自定义函数

    def normalize(x):return (x - x.mean()) / x.std()
    df.groupby('group').apply(normalize)

1.16 字符串操作

  • 正则匹配

    df['text'].str.extract(r'(\d+)')        # 提取数字
    df['text'].str.replace(r'\d+', 'NUM')   # 替换数字
    1.17 索引进阶
  • 条件筛选

    df.query('age > 30 & salary > 5000')    # 查询语法
    df.loc[df['age'] > 30, 'name']          # 标签定位
    索引优化:

        

df = df.sort_index()                    # 索引排序提升查询速度

1.18 Pandas绘图操作

  • 集成 Matplotlib

    df.plot(x='date', y='price', kind='line')  # 折线图
    df['sales'].plot.hist(bins=20)           # 直方图

1.19 大数据处理技巧

  • 分块读取

    chunk_iter = pd.read_csv('large.csv', chunksize=10000)  # 分块读取
    for chunk in chunk_iter:process(chunk)
  • 内存优化

    df = df.astype({'col1': 'int32', 'col2': 'category'})  # 降低内存占用
  • 并行处理

    import swifter
    df['new_col'] = df['col'].swifter.apply(lambda x: x*2)  # 利用多核加速
    总结
  • 核心数据结构Series 和 DataFrame 是 Pandas 的基石。

  • 数据操作四要素索引分组合并清洗

  • 性能优化:类型转换、分块处理、并行计算。

  • 实战场景:金融数据分析、日志处理、时间序列预测。

http://www.dtcms.com/wzjs/63036.html

相关文章:

  • 重庆建设工程公司网站优化网站的步骤
  • 北京造价信息网官网绍兴百度seo
  • 唐山玉田孤树做宣传上什么网站重庆网站排名公司
  • 网站英文版是怎么做的广东seo
  • 做代理需要自己的网站吗河南关键词排名顾问
  • 公司网站建设费属于宣传费吗精准营销
  • 欧米茄女士手表网站搜索引擎大全排行榜
  • 专业网站制作技术镇江seo
  • 泉州软件开发培训seo搜索引擎排名优化
  • phpcms网站后台即时热榜
  • 毕业设计代做网站web西安网络推广外包公司
  • 什么网站免费购物商城推广普通话手抄报内容怎么写
  • 微官网和手机网站一样吗公司建网站流程
  • 哪些网站用织梦默认模板如何搜索网页关键词
  • 济南建网站搜索百度app下载
  • web前端工作嘉兴seo
  • 网站html地图制作百度收录提交网站后多久收录
  • 网页设计要学些什么seo数据优化教程
  • 建设集团网站公司搜索引擎优化简称
  • 济南ui设计制作培训淘宝关键词排名优化技巧
  • web网站开发的书电商网页制作教程
  • 如何制作一个自己的网站?百度识图鉴你所见
  • 辽宁省交通建设投资集团网站建立公司网站需要多少钱
  • wordpress给文章设置标题seo推广专员工作好做吗
  • 网站页面示意图怎么做今日新闻10条简短
  • 各家建站平台网站首页布局设计模板
  • 如何给自己网站做反链一个新公众号怎么吸粉
  • wordpress经常502鼓楼网页seo搜索引擎优化
  • 做的网站为什么图片看不了北京学校线上教学
  • 哈尔滨编程课哪个机构最好网站自然优化